Latest Patents

Dellamano's most recent patent, titled "Powerfactor correcting flyback arrangement having a resonant capacitor," introduces a ballast circuit that enhances the performance of gas discharge lamps. This innovative circuit consists of three sections: an input power section, a pre-regulator section, and a lamp driver section. The design features a transformer with several windings and a current sense winding, enabling efficient current control in a flyback configuration. Additional components include a resonant capacitor that harmonizes the operation of the circuit, significantly improving its efficiency.

Another notable patent involves a "Method and improved apparatus for analyzing heart activity," which provides simultaneous electrical representations of both the electrical and acoustical activity of the heart. This invention utilizes a pickup device to create a full wave rectified heart sound signal, augmented by pulses from the QRS wave of the electrocardiogram. The design allows for direct application to the skin, optimizing response times during heart activity monitoring.
